| 3D Camera to help cars park themselves |
QinetiQ is working with several of the automotive sectors leading suppliers to integrate its newly developed 3-D cameras into future vehicle designs. The novel cameras meet a number of spatial sensing requirements - which could ultimately lead to all cars being able to self-park.

| Plumbing in Government with Maps on Taps |
A major e-government initiative is set to provide all Government departments with access to high quality, up-to-date digital mapping information and decision support tools. This has led to the award of a contract to a consortium led by QinetiQ.
The "Maps on Tap" service will enhance area-based decision making across Government, by offering desktop access to a vast amount of digital geographic information and analytical tools from one place for the first time.
